Weds Feb 1st – Continue working through Level F And G Number work

LEARNING OBJECTIVE: To revise level G (and some F) number work, focussing on number work.

SUCCESS CRITERIA: You will be able to solve level G/F number problems
You will be confident and well practiced with all of the following number problems

  • Adding in grids – all completed
  • All times tables up to 10's
  • Multiplying and dividing by 10, 100, 1000
  • BODMAS
  • Understand Place Value
  • Round numbers to nearest 10, 100, 1000
  • Adding and subtracting up to 4 digits using column method
  • Multiplying and dividing by single digits
  • Representing Fractions
  • Adding/Subtracting Fractions with same denominator
  • Equivalent Fractions
  • Adding/Subtracting Fractions with different denominators

STARTER:
Times it out – play as a class and then freeze IWB and get individuals to play for 5 mins each throughout the lesson


LESSON:
Continue to work through Chapter 5 & then Chapter 6 of text book you MUST Complete ALL questions in an exercise before you move on
work around room marking students work, supporting students at their desks...

Ongoing Individual Activity at Teacher Machine / ON Laptop - Times it out - get individuals to play for 5 mins each throughout the lesson

EXTENSION: Move on through rest of this chapters in a similar way – have a go at a couple of questions if too easy move to ext question if not practice more questions.


PLENARIES: Checking answers form back of book
